Output 4668f26a50faca2a36b660ccd9e939ffb3097ce5f31297e95798ae458791201a:18

value
343340
script pubkey
OP_0 OP_PUSHBYTES_20 a372df0624ed87260498644ca2a51ecca18b76a3
address
bc1q5ded7p3yakrjvpycv3x29fg7ejscka4rt6zfha
transaction
4668f26a50faca2a36b660ccd9e939ffb3097ce5f31297e95798ae458791201a